In the digital age, the concept of digital competence has gained critical significance, prompting a diverse range of academic and institutional definitions. This article provides a comprehensive review of related terms and conceptual frameworks, including computer literacy, information literacy, media literacy, e-literacy, digital literacy, and e-competence. It traces the historical development of these concepts and highlights their evolution in response to technological advances and societal needs. By examining key definitions and models proposed by UNESCO, the European Commission, and scholars such as Gilster, Eshet-Alkalai, and Ferrari, the review identifies both overlaps and distinctions among the terms. The analysis reveals two primary perspectives: one that treats digital competence as a convergence of multiple literacies, and another that positions it as a distinct and holistic literacy. Ultimately, this synthesis contributes to a clearer understanding of digital competence as a multifaceted and dynamic construct essential for effective functioning in digital environments across educational, professional, and personal contexts.
